A process for adsorbing gold from a leach pulp by means of activated carbon is described in which the leach pulp (the leach solution together with the subdivided gold bearing ore) is diluted to a specific gravity of less than that of the activated carbon and is subsequently passed upwardly through a multistage liquid/solid contacting column.

Activated carbon has long been used as an adsorbent in the gold processing industry to recover gold from mining operations. Due to its high surface area and exceptional hardness, coconut shell GAC (granulated activated carbon) is the main product used in carbon-in-leach (CIL), carbon-in-pulp (CIP), and carbon-in-column (CIC) operating systems.

Gold CIP/CIL Plant Introduction CIL (Carbon In Leach) leaching process, that is, carbon leaching gold extraction, is a process of adding activated carbon to the pulp and leaching and adsorbing gold at the same time, which simplifies the CIP (Carbon In Pulp) process.

The carbon in pulp method is only used where tank leaching is utilized for the recovery of gold from the ores and this is not the case in most large gold mines today, since heap leaching is the lowest cost method for recovering gold from ores containing from a few grams to 5 or 6 grams per ton.

CIP ( Carbon In Pulp) process is suitable for the treatment of oxidized gold ore with low sulfur content and mud content.It is unsuitable for the gold ore with high-grade silver as well. Generally, the proportion of gold and silver should not exceed 1:5. The best conditions for Carbon In Pulp process in China: PH=10-12, sodium cyanide concentration is not less than 0.015%, the particle size of ...

Carbon-in-Pulp (CIP) and Carbon-in-Leach (CIL) processes have surface areas of about 1000 m²/g i.e. one gram of activated carbon (the amount of which will occupy the same space as the end of a person's thumb) has the same surface area as two football fields. This paper presents water the footprint assessment (WFA) of carbon in pulp (CIP) gold processing. The main objectives of the study are determining grey and blue water footprints and identifying the hotspots of the process. Results revealed that the total blue water footprint, including the extraction and processing of the gold, was found to be 452.40 m3/kg Au, and the grey WF to be 2300.69 m3 ...

The carbon-in-leach process integrates leaching and carbon-in-pulp into a single unit process operation in which the leach tanks are fitted with carbon retention screens and the carbon-in-pulp tanks are eliminated. The activated carbon is added in leach, with gold adsorption occurring nearly simultaneously with gold dissolution ...
